KUALA LUMPUR – Pokok Sena MP Datuk Mahfuz Omar has submitted a notice of no confidence against the prime minister, becoming the sixth lawmaker to do so since yesterday.
The Amanah vice-president’s move follows that by five Pejuang parliamentarians, among them party founder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ad.
The other four – Kubang Pasu MP Datuk Amiruddin Hamzah, Maszlee Malik (Simpang Renggam), Datuk Seri Mukhriz Mahathir (Jerlun) and Datuk Shahruddin Salleh (Sri Gading) – have submitted letters to Dewan Rakyat Speaker Datuk Azhar Azizan Harun, seeking the tabling of the motion against Tan Sri Muhyiddin Yassin at the next Parliament sitting, which will begin on November 2.
Former prime minister Dr Mahathir first filed a motion against Muhyiddin in May. – The Vibes, October 16, 2020
